Product details

The DSC1001DI1-026.0000 is a 26 MHz MEMS-based XO (Standard) from Microchip's DSC1001 series, delivering a CMOS output from a 1.8V to 3.3V supply rail. The MEMS base resonator replaces a quartz crystal — no load-capacitance matching needed, and the part resists the shock and temperature cycling that can crack a quartz blank.

Operating from 1.8V to 3.3V, this single oscillator covers both low-voltage SoC cores and 3.3V peripheral buses — one BOM line serves multiple voltage domains. Active current draw is 6.3 mA max at 26 MHz — low enough that a 3.3V LDO feeding the oscillator does not need a heatsink or wide PCB trace.
